About this Course

L5: This course focuses on basic English communication skills for intermediate English learners. Topics covered include presentations and verbal summary.

Learning modules

  • week 1
    • Conversation: Paper vs. Digital, Impromptu Speech: Which is better?

    • Conversation, Videos/Note Taking, Impromptu Speech: Which is better for taking notes: handwriting or typing?

    • Video Homework

  • week 2
    • Conversation, Videos/Note Taking, Impromptu Speech: Which is better for today's modern life: being a night owl or an early bird?

    • Conversation, Videos/Note Taking, Impromptu Speech: What are the effects of sleep deprivation?

    • Conversation, Videos/Note Taking

    • Impromptu Speech: The effects of Stress and How to reduce stress (5.LS.1+4)

    • Paraphrase and Summary Overview and Practice

    • Paraphrase and Summary Homework

  • week 3
    • Paraphrase and Summary Practice

    • Paraphrase and Summary Practice

    • Paraphrase Details Quiz

    • Summary Quiz

    • Choose Video for Presentation

  • week 4
    • Presentation Work Day: Creating the speech

    • Presentation Work Day: Creating the poster

    • Presentation Work Day: Speech and Poster

    • Presentation
